[英]Choose sorting order of methods in Eclipse's auto-completion proposals?
當我輸入一個.
在編寫對象實例的名稱之后,Eclipse顯示了此實例可用的所有方法的列表,包括對象擴展的超類方法。
如果我正在使用實現某個接口的對象,我必須在“無聊的”對象級方法(如notify()
或getClass()
搜索“有趣”的方法。
我可以讓Eclipse對方法進行排序,以便在子類中聲明的方法首先出現嗎?
要改變排序:
轉到Preferences
> Java
> Editor
> Content Assist
> Sorting and Filtering
。
過濾條目:
轉到Preferences
> Java
> Appearance
> Type filters
。
通常我們不使用自動完成來研究對象接口。 好的,我有時會這樣做,就像我想要看到所有的getter一樣 - 但在這種情況下我只需輸入.get
並有一個過濾列表。
通常,自動完成用於加速編碼 - 鍵入方法名稱的前幾個字母(例如)並點擊返回。 這甚至不需要排序。 (如果,那我真的更喜歡升序按字母順序排列)。
為了研究界面,我認為它要好一點,在單獨的編輯器中打開對象類型並檢查大綱視圖和java文檔。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.